编程已经成为现代社会不可或缺的一部分。在众多编程语言中,Python因其简洁易懂、功能强大等特点,被广泛应用于各个领域。而刷砖代码,作为Python编程中的一种,更是以其独特的魅力吸引了众多开发者。本文将带领大家深入探索刷砖代码背后的智慧,探讨技术与艺术的完美融合。

一、什么是刷砖代码?

探索刷砖代码背后的智慧技术与艺术的完美融合  第1张

刷砖代码,顾名思义,就是指用于刷取砖块(游戏货币)的代码。这类代码通常应用于手机游戏、网页游戏等领域,通过编写特定的程序,实现自动刷取游戏货币的功能。刷砖代码的实质,是将复杂的游戏逻辑转化为简单的代码实现,从而实现高效的游戏体验。

二、刷砖代码的技术原理

1. 游戏数据抓取

刷砖代码首先要完成的是游戏数据的抓取。这需要开发者对游戏界面进行分析,找出游戏货币所在的位置,并使用图像识别、OCR等技术将其转换为可处理的文本数据。

2. 游戏逻辑分析

在获取游戏数据的基础上,开发者需要分析游戏逻辑,找出刷取货币的关键步骤。这包括游戏角色移动、点击、按键等操作。通过对游戏逻辑的分析,开发者可以编写相应的代码,实现自动操作。

3. 自动化实现

自动化是实现刷砖代码的关键。开发者需要使用Python的自动化库,如pyautogui、pywinauto等,实现游戏操作的自动化。还可以利用多线程、多进程等技术,提高刷砖代码的执行效率。

三、刷砖代码的艺术价值

1. 简化游戏操作

刷砖代码将复杂的游戏操作简化为简单的代码实现,让玩家可以更加专注于游戏本身,提高游戏体验。

2. 创新思维

刷砖代码的编写过程,需要开发者具备创新思维。在分析游戏逻辑、编写代码的过程中,开发者需要不断尝试、改进,以达到最佳效果。

3. 技术与艺术的结合

刷砖代码将技术与艺术完美融合。在追求高效、简洁的代码实现过程中,开发者需要在艺术表现、用户体验等方面进行深入研究。

四、刷砖代码的应用领域

1. 游戏开发

刷砖代码可以帮助游戏开发者提高游戏测试效率,降低人力成本。开发者还可以通过刷砖代码实现游戏功能的创新。

2. 自动化测试

刷砖代码在自动化测试领域具有广泛的应用。通过编写自动化测试脚本,可以实现对游戏功能的全面测试,提高测试效率。

3. 机器人研究

刷砖代码在机器人研究领域具有很高的应用价值。通过研究刷砖代码,可以实现对机器人操作行为的优化,提高机器人智能化水平。

刷砖代码作为Python编程中的一种,以其独特的魅力吸引了众多开发者。它不仅展示了编程技术的魅力,更体现了技术与艺术的完美融合。在未来的发展中,刷砖代码将在更多领域发挥重要作用,为人们创造更加美好的生活。